This will be indicated in the amendment table on the inside front cover.BS1054:1975 BSI 06-1999 1 1 Scope This British Standard specifies requirements for comparators having
15、 magnification factors of 250 and over. The type of comparator to which the requirements are primarily intended to apply is an instrument comprising a rigid stand supporting a measuring head over a work table. The measuring head is provided with a measuring tip whose movements are amplified and indi
16、cated on a scale in metric units. The means of amplification may be mechanical, electrical, electronic, optical, fluid or pneumatic. 2 Definitions For the purposes of this standard, the following definitions apply. 2.1 deviation from flatness the minimum distance between two parallel planes which ju
17、st envelop the measuring face (see Figure 1) NOTEIt may be necessary to control the maximum slope of the surface deviations with respect to the enclosing planes. 2.2 flatness tolerance the maximum permissible deviation from flatness 3 Design features The instrument shall be of rigid construction and
18、 first class workmanship throughout. Particular attention should be paid to the rigidity of the vertical post or bracket which carries the measuring head and to the method of supporting the work table. The distance between the measuring head and work table shall be adjustable to suit workpieces of d
19、ifferent sizes within the stated capacity of the instrument. The base shall be of rigid construction and shall be provided with three feet. It should provide facilities for interchanging work tables. The measuring head shall be provided with a coarse adjustment for the accommodation of work within t
20、he capacity of the instrument. This coarse adjustment shall be smooth in operation and be provided with means of preventing free falling movement of the measuring head in the unclamped position. Means shall also be provided for finely adjusting the relative position of the measuring head to the work
21、 table and for clamping this fine adjustment in such a way as to ensure that the setting is maintained within one tenth of a division of the scale. The mechanism within the measuring head shall be provided with effective means of preventing damage to it in the event of the measuring tip being raised
22、 abnormally or suddenly released. 4 Work table The work table shall be made of steel or of an alternative material of comparable wearing properties, for example, of granite or of steel with tungsten carbide inserts, with or without grooves. Steel work tables shall be hardened over the working surfac
23、e to not less than HV850 (RockwellC63) and, after hardening, shall be suitably heat treated to give stability. The surface of the work table shall be finished by lapping and shall be flat to within the following tolerances. The tolerances specified for flatness shall apply tothe full working surface
24、 when the work table is75mm in diameter or smaller and to any area75mm in diameter for larger work tables.
